WebDec 28, 2011 · In algebra, we learn that if a function $ f(x) $ has a one-to-one mapping, then we can find the inverse function $ f^{-1}(x) $. The method that I have seen taught is the "horizontal line test": if any horizontal line touches the graph of the function more than once, then it must not be one-to-one. WebThe Lesson A function and its inverse function can be plotted on a graph. If the function is plotted as y = f(x), we can reflect it in the line y = x to plot the inverse function y = f −1 (x). Every point on a function with Cartesian coordinates (x, y) becomes the point (y, x) on the inverse function: the coordinates are swapped around. The inverse of a … WebBy assigning arbitrary values on Y∖f(X), you get a left inverse for your function. How do you know if a matrix is injective? Let A be a matrix and let Ared be the row reduced form of A. If Ared has a leading 1 in every column, then A is injective. If Ared has a column without a leading 1 in it, then A is not injective. WebDec 14, 2024 · The steps involved in getting the inverse of a function are: Step 1: Determine if the function is one to one. Step 2: Interchange the x and y variables. Step 3: If the result is an equation, solve the equation for y. Step 4: Replace y by f-1 (x), symbolizing the inverse function or the inverse of f.

WebJan 10, 2024 · Not all functions have inverse functions. Those that do are called invertible. For a function f: X → Y to have an inverse, it must have the property that for every y in Y, there is exactly one x in X such that f (x) = y.
